- W2188405219 abstract "Carbon dioxide (CO 2 ) is linked to a patient’s perfusion, ventilation, and metabolism. Endtidal carbon dioxide (ETCO 2 ) is the measurement of CO 2 in exhaled respiratory gases and serves as an estimate of arterial CO 2 . ETCO 2 is measured by a capnograph in a mainstream or sidestream method. A normal capnogram has four phases: phase 0, the inspiratory downstroke; phase I, the expiratory baseline; phase II, the expiratory upstroke; and phase III, the expiratory plateau. Complete evaluation of a capnogram includes determining the shape and value of the four phases and measuring the alveolar to end-tidal CO 2 gradient. Thorough evaluation gives a clinician information about a patient’s state of perfusion, ventilation, and metabolism as well as equipment malfunction. Further veterinary studies are needed to determine the role of capnography in monitoring anesthetized patients, assessing response to treatment, diagnosing disease, and determining a prognosis." @default.
